Title: Gerhard Baron: Innovating Gasification Processes in Hofheim, Germany
Introduction
Gerhard Baron, an accomplished inventor based in Hofheim, Germany, has made significant contributions to the field of gasification technology. With a remarkable portfolio of 10 patents, his innovative work primarily focuses on processes that enhance the efficiency of converting fine-grained solid fuels into valuable gases.
Latest Patents
Baron's latest patents showcase his expertise in gasifying solid fuels. One notable patent describes a process of gasifying fine-grained solid fuels, which aims to produce a product gas enriched with hydrogen, carbon oxides, and methane. This process involves the treatment of the fuels with steam, oxygen, and/or carbon dioxide in two interconnected gasifying stages under specific pressure and temperature conditions.
The first gasifying stage employs a circulating fluidized bed to treat the fuel, while the residual solids are transferred to the second stage where they are almost entirely gasified with an oxygen-rich gasifying agent. Remarkably, the process enables the recycling of a portion of the product gas back to the first stage, enhancing efficiency and effectiveness.
Another patent highlights his invention related to producing coal briquettes intended for gasification or devolatilization. These briquettes consist mainly of coal mixed with 10 to 30% by weight of additional ash. The resulting briquettes possess the necessary strength to withstand gasification or carbonization processes in fixed beds.
Career Highlights
Gerhard Baron has had a distinguished career, contributing his expertise to several reputable companies, including Metallgesellschaft Aktiengesellschaft and Ruhrgas Aktiengesellschaft. His work in these organizations has played a pivotal role in developing innovative technologies that advance the field of fuel processing.
Collaborations
Throughout his career, Baron collaborated with notable colleagues, including Carl Hafke and Herbert Bierbach. These partnerships have undoubtedly enriched his work, allowing him to leverage collective knowledge and insights to further enhance gasification technologies.
